PERIPUTOS: Purity evaluated by Raman intensity of pristine and ultracentrifuged topping of single-wall carbon nanotubes

摘要

A quantitative purity evaluation of single-wall carbon nanotubes (SWCNTs) using resonance Raman spectroscopy was proposed. Linearity between purity and G-band Raman intensity of isolated SWCNT solution was confirmed and quantitative purity was evaluated directly from an intensity ratio of pristine and high-purity SWCNTs prepared by ultracentrifugation. We confirmed that the purity evaluated by Raman intensity of pristine and ultracentrifuged topping of SWCNTs [purity evaluated by Raman intensity of pristine and ultracentrifuged topping of single-wall carbon nanotubes (PERIPUTOS)] gave the same value for the different laser wavelengths and could be applied to any kinds of SWCNT.
